epa02671905 A Japanese mother and her children are on their way to an evacuation center in the tsunami-devastated coastal town of Otsuchi, Iwate Prefecture, northeastern Japan on 06 April 2011. More than 12,000 have been confirmed killed by a 9.0-magnitude earthquake and subsequent tsunami that hit the northeastern Japan and more than 15,000 are still missing, according to the National Police Agency.
